Question
Hi, I've started boxing only when I was 20 and it was just a normal training with lots of emphasis on techniques in punching and some sparring but not training for competition.  Recently, I joined a gym that provides an opportunity to fight and started training there. I'm the only lady in the class and was pretty unsure about my ability in the beginnig. However, there were a few trainers who actually complimented me on my skills and techniques which gave me more confidence in training there and preparing myself to fight. But I wonder if it's too late for me to start a proper training at the age of 23 now to prepare for competition. Besides that, as I'm short-sighted, I wonder if it's legal to wear contact lenses in a fight? Thank you!

Answer
Yes, you have plenty of time to start training for competition.  I sincerely hope that your gym is registered with USA Boxing and that the trainers are familiar with Olympic-style boxing techniques and rules.  Any boxer with uncorrected vision between 20/20 and 20/400 is permitted to wear soft contact lenses.  If the lens comes out and the boxer cannot continue, the boxer losing the lens will lose the bout.
